The wind in Death Valley is strong primarily due to the region's unique topography and temperature variations. The valley's low elevation and surrounding mountain ranges create a funneling effect that accelerates winds. Additionally, the intense heat in the valley can create pressure differences, causing air to rush from cooler areas to the hotter, lower regions. This combination of factors results in the powerful winds characteristic of Death Valley.

The highest temperature on the Earth was in Death Valley, on July 10, 1913, reaching a temperature of 134F, or 56.7C. The sun, by contrast, is far hotter, being at a temperature of 9,941F, or 5,505C. That is a difference of 9,807F and 5,448.3C.
